NZDF Civilian Recognition of Service Badge

Overview

The NZDF Civilian Recognition of Service Badge was introduced in September 2022 to formally recognise the commitment and contribution of NZDF civilians, who support Defence activities.

Description

The Civilian Recognition Badge features a central image of the New Zealand Defence Force emblem surrounded by the words "Comradeship," "Courage," "Integrity," and "Commitment".  This central image is embossed in gold, silver, or bronze depending on the length of service. A black ring bearing the words "In Recognition of Service Te Ope Katua O Aotearoa" encircles the central image.  

Eligibility

Badges are awarded according to the length of cumulative civilian service to individuals who were employed by NZDF on or after 1 January 2022.  Military service does not count towards the NZDF Civilian Recognition of Service.

  • The Bronze Badge is awarded for five years of cumulative service
  • The Silver Badge is awarded for fifteen years of cumulative service
  • The Gold Badge is awarded for thirty years of cumulative service

Gold Badges are presented by the respective Service Chief or portfolio head.  Silver Badges are presented by the Commanding Officer or equivalent, and Bronze Badges are presented by the Manager or equivalent.

Queries & requests

  • Wearing this badge

    The Civilian Recognition of Service Badge is not approved for wear on military uniform. 

    Recipients may wear the badge recognising the greatest length of service awarded to the recipient on civilian clothing on the left side at chest height.

  • Checking eligibility and applying for this badge

    There is no application process for the Civilian Recognition of Service Badge. 

    When you become eligible for the NZDF Civilian Recognition of Service Badge, you will receive an automated notification.  Your manager will coordinate the delivery, presentation, and recording of your badge in your SAP record.  Badges are processed on a quarterly basis, so there may be a delay between confirmation and delivery of the badge.

    If you believe you are eligible for a NZDF Civilian Recognition of Service Badge but have not received a notification, please contact People Services.

  • Checking if this badge was issued

    The NZDF Civilian Recognition of Service Badge is recorded in your SAP HCM record.
